What I Look for First
When I shop for backup lighting, I always start with the basics: brightness, runtime, charging method, and ease of use. I want something I can trust without having to think too much during an outage. If it is too complicated, I know I may not use it properly when I need it most.
Brightness and Light Coverage
I pay close attention to how bright the light is. A small flashlight may be enough for walking around, but I prefer something that can illuminate a room if the outage lasts a while. I also consider whether the light is focused or wide-spread, because I need different types of lighting for different situations.
Battery Life and Runtime
For me, runtime matters just as much as brightness. I do not want a light that burns bright for only a short time and then dies. I usually look for backup lights that can last several hours on a single charge or set of batteries, especially if I live in an area where outages can last through the night.
Charging Options I Prefer
I like backup lighting that offers flexible charging options. Rechargeable batteries, USB charging, solar charging, and hand-crank features all appeal to me depending on the product. If I can recharge it easily during normal days, I feel more confident that it will be ready when the power goes out.
Types of Backup Lighting I Consider
I usually compare a few different options before buying:
- Flashlights: I keep these for portability and quick use.
- Lanterns: I like these when I need to light up a whole room.
- Rechargeable emergency bulbs: These are helpful because they can work in existing fixtures.
- Headlamps: I use these when I need hands-free lighting.
- Battery-powered night lights: I find these useful for hallways and bathrooms.
Ease of Storage and Access
I always think about where I will keep the light so I can find it fast. A backup light is only useful if I can reach it quickly in the dark. I prefer compact designs or lights that can stay plugged in and ready to use. I also keep extra batteries in the same place if the product needs them.
Durability and Build Quality
I want backup lighting that feels sturdy enough to handle regular use and occasional drops. During a power outage, I may be moving around in the dark, so durability matters to me. I usually choose lights with solid construction and, if possible, water resistance for extra peace of mind.
Safety Features I Appreciate
When I buy backup lighting, I look for features that make it safer to use. Overcharge protection, cool-to-the-touch materials, stable bases for lanterns, and low-heat bulbs are all important to me. I want lighting that helps me avoid accidents rather than creating new risks.
My Budget Considerations
I try to balance cost with reliability. I do not always need the most expensive option, but I also do not want the cheapest one if it may fail when I need it. I usually compare value based on battery life, brightness, charging options, and durability instead of price alone.
My Final Buying Advice
If I were choosing backup lighting for power outages today, I would buy at least two types: one portable light like a flashlight or headlamp, and one room-filling option like a lantern or emergency bulb. That way, I feel prepared for both short outages and longer ones. My goal is always the same: to stay safe, comfortable, and ready when the power goes out.
